im即时通讯接入的语音识别错误率如何降低?
随着科技的不断发展,即时通讯工具已经成为人们日常生活中不可或缺的一部分。语音识别技术在即时通讯中的应用越来越广泛,但语音识别错误率的问题一直困扰着用户。本文将针对“im即时通讯接入的语音识别错误率如何降低?”这个问题,从多个角度进行分析和探讨。
一、提高语音识别准确率的技术手段
- 优化语音前端处理
(1)降噪技术:在语音识别过程中,噪声会严重影响识别准确率。采用先进的降噪技术,如波束形成、谱减法等,可以有效降低噪声对语音识别的影响。
(2)增强语音质量:通过提升语音的清晰度、降低背景噪声等手段,提高语音质量,从而降低识别错误率。
(3)说话人识别:通过说话人识别技术,识别出不同说话人的语音特征,实现个性化语音识别,提高识别准确率。
- 优化语音识别算法
(1)深度学习:利用深度学习技术,如卷积神经网络(CNN)、循环神经网络(RNN)等,提高语音识别的准确率。
(2)端到端模型:采用端到端模型,将语音信号直接映射到文字序列,减少中间环节,提高识别准确率。
(3)注意力机制:引入注意力机制,使模型更加关注语音信号中的关键信息,提高识别准确率。
- 优化语音后端处理
(1)语言模型优化:通过优化语言模型,提高语音识别结果的流畅性和准确性。
(2)声学模型优化:通过优化声学模型,提高语音识别的准确率。
二、降低语音识别错误率的策略
- 提高用户参与度
(1)引导用户正确发音:在语音识别过程中,引导用户正确发音,提高语音质量。
(2)提供反馈:在识别错误时,及时给出反馈,引导用户修正发音。
- 优化语音识别界面
(1)简化操作流程:简化语音识别操作流程,降低用户使用门槛。
(2)提高识别速度:提高语音识别速度,减少用户等待时间。
- 优化语音识别场景
(1)适应不同场景:针对不同场景,如室内、室外、嘈杂环境等,优化语音识别算法,提高识别准确率。
(2)支持方言识别:针对不同地区方言,优化语音识别算法,提高方言识别准确率。
- 持续优化和更新
(1)收集用户反馈:收集用户在使用过程中的反馈,不断优化语音识别系统。
(2)持续更新模型:根据语音识别技术的发展,持续更新语音识别模型,提高识别准确率。
三、总结
降低im即时通讯接入的语音识别错误率,需要从技术手段、策略和持续优化等方面入手。通过优化语音前端处理、语音识别算法和语音后端处理,提高语音识别准确率。同时,通过提高用户参与度、优化语音识别界面、优化语音识别场景和持续优化更新,降低语音识别错误率。相信随着技术的不断进步,语音识别技术将在im即时通讯中发挥越来越重要的作用。
猜你喜欢:网站即时通讯